Stagecoach Theatre Arts have been nurturing and developing young people's potential for over 21 years. With over 700 schools worldwide and more than 40,000 students, Stagecoach is the longest running and most successful performing arts schools network in the world. We not only deliver quality performance arts training but ensure that each child gets the most out of their experience by building life skills and confidence while having a lot of fun and meeting new friends. Every student from aged 4-18 years participates in each of the three musical theatre disciplines - Drama, Dance and Singing. Each three hour session for 6-18 year old is split into three 1-hour classes, where young people get the chance to learn each skill in small class sizes of similar ages. Children aged 4-6 years are introduced to Stagecoach through Early Stages classes which run for a shorter period of 90 minutes, split into three 30 minute sessions in dance, drama and singing. As we keep class sizes small (15 maximum) we are able to nurture young raw talent alongside encouraging and inspiring those who might need additional confidence building. Often copied, but never equalled, Stagecoach has remained the market leader for children's performing arts, reaching beyond the scope of normal after-school clubs. In addition to the opportunity for students to take internationally recognised examinations, young people get regular reports and awards for long standing achievement. There is also the option for students to audition for professional work in film, theatre and modelling via the Stagecoach Agency. The Stagecoach Charitable Trust was set up in January 2000 to spread the benefit of acting, singing and dancing beyond Stagecoach's traditional classes. Often children and parents can be dissuaded from joining a 'mainstream' group because they cannot afford the fees, because the group either doesn't cater for 'special needs' or because they fear being different from the majority of people within the group. The most significant difference of the Stagecoach Charitable Trust's InterAct programme is its total 'inclusivity'. At InterAct, young people are offered the chance to experience the three disciplines not only from a technique point of view, but also from the socialising point of view. One of the most crucial aspects of InterAct is the aim to bring together groups of young people from all backgrounds, to have fun.
